Output 00267227506036b59daaeff446b93ece0f80fd7b06b3d95d2cb400dd3b680050:1

value
27602578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 279bc38f9d00c173bcb93a23a8243554d10c8fc1 OP_EQUAL
address
MBWbBaTv6v43vTikjUnGuEGLfZ9KK49j9F
transaction
00267227506036b59daaeff446b93ece0f80fd7b06b3d95d2cb400dd3b680050
spent
true